#include "WP3Parser.h"
#include <memory>
#include "WPXHeader.h"
#include "WP3Part.h"
#include "WP3ContentListener.h"
#include "WP3StylesListener.h"
#include "WP3ResourceFork.h"
#include "libwpd_internal.h"
#include "WPXTable.h"
WP3Parser::WP3Parser(librevenge::RVNGInputStream *input, WPXHeader *header, WPXEncryption *encryption) :
WPXParser(input, header, encryption)
{
}
WP3Parser::~WP3Parser()
{
}
WP3ResourceFork *WP3Parser::getResourceFork(librevenge::RVNGInputStream *input, WPXEncryption *encryption)
{
// Certain WP2 documents actually don't contain resource fork, so check for its existence
if (!getHeader() || getHeader()->getDocumentOffset() <= 0x10)
{
WPD_DEBUG_MSG(("WP3Parser: Document does not contain resource fork\n"));
return nullptr;
}
return new WP3ResourceFork(input, encryption);
}
void WP3Parser::parse(librevenge::RVNGInputStream *input, WPXEncryption *encryption, WP3Listener *listener)
{
listener->startDocument();
input->seek(getHeader()->getDocumentOffset(), librevenge::RVNG_SEEK_SET);
WPD_DEBUG_MSG(("WordPerfect: Starting document body parse (position = %ld)\n",(long)input->tell()));
parseDocument(input, encryption, listener);
listener->endDocument();
}
// parseDocument: parses a document body (may call itself recursively, on other streams, or itself)
void WP3Parser::parseDocument(librevenge::RVNGInputStream *input, WPXEncryption *encryption, WP3Listener *listener)
{
while (!input->isEnd())
{
unsigned char readVal;
readVal = readU8(input, encryption);
if (readVal == 0 || readVal == 0x7F || readVal == 0xFF)
{
// FIXME: VERIFY: is this IF clause correct? (0xFF seems to be OK at least)
// do nothing: this token is meaningless and is likely just corruption
}
else if (readVal >= (unsigned char)0x01 && readVal <= (unsigned char)0x1F)
{
// control characters ?
}
else if (readVal >= (unsigned char)0x20 && readVal <= (unsigned char)0x7E)
{
listener->insertCharacter(readVal);
}
else
{
std::unique_ptr<WP3Part> part(WP3Part::constructPart(input, encryption, readVal));
if (part)
part->parse(listener);
}
}
}
void WP3Parser::parse(librevenge::RVNGTextInterface *textInterface)
{
librevenge::RVNGInputStream *input = getInput();
WPXEncryption *encryption = getEncryption();
std::list<WPXPageSpan> pageList;
WPXTableList tableList;
WP3ResourceFork *resourceFork = nullptr;
std::vector<WP3SubDocument *> subDocuments;
try
{
resourceFork = getResourceFork(input, encryption);
// do a "first-pass" parse of the document
// gather table border information, page properties (per-page)
WP3StylesListener stylesListener(pageList, tableList, subDocuments);
stylesListener.setResourceFork(resourceFork);
parse(input, encryption, &stylesListener);
// postprocess the pageList == remove duplicate page spans due to the page breaks
std::list<WPXPageSpan>::iterator previousPage = pageList.begin();
for (std::list<WPXPageSpan>::iterator Iter=pageList.begin(); Iter != pageList.end(); /* Iter++ */)
{
if ((Iter != previousPage) && (*previousPage==*Iter))
{
(*previousPage).setPageSpan((*previousPage).getPageSpan() + (*Iter).getPageSpan());
Iter = pageList.erase(Iter);
}
else
{
previousPage = Iter;
++Iter;
}
}
// second pass: here is where we actually send the messages to the target app
// that are necessary to emit the body of the target document
WP3ContentListener listener(pageList, subDocuments, textInterface); // FIXME: SHOULD BE CONTENT_LISTENER, AND SHOULD BE PASSED TABLE DATA!
listener.setResourceFork(resourceFork);
parse(input, encryption, &listener);
// cleanup section: free the used resources
for (auto &subDocument : subDocuments)
{
if (subDocument)
delete subDocument;
}
delete resourceFork;
}
catch (FileException)
{
WPD_DEBUG_MSG(("WordPerfect: File Exception. Parse terminated prematurely."));
for (auto &subDocument : subDocuments)
{
if (subDocument)
delete subDocument;
}
delete resourceFork;
throw FileException();
}
}
void WP3Parser::parseSubDocument(librevenge::RVNGTextInterface *textInterface)
{
std::list<WPXPageSpan> pageList;
WPXTableList tableList;
std::vector<WP3SubDocument *> subDocuments;
librevenge::RVNGInputStream *input = getInput();
try
{
WP3StylesListener stylesListener(pageList, tableList, subDocuments);
stylesListener.startSubDocument();
parseDocument(input, nullptr, &stylesListener);
stylesListener.endSubDocument();
input->seek(0, librevenge::RVNG_SEEK_SET);
WP3ContentListener listener(pageList, subDocuments, textInterface);
listener.startSubDocument();
parseDocument(input, nullptr, &listener);
listener.endSubDocument();
for (auto &subDocument : subDocuments)
if (subDocument)
delete subDocument;
}
catch (FileException)
{
WPD_DEBUG_MSG(("WordPerfect: File Exception. Parse terminated prematurely."));
for (auto &subDocument : subDocuments)
if (subDocument)
delete subDocument;
throw FileException();
}
}
